Default Another gear question.

Thanks to all I've read here, I have settled on the 4.10's. But I don't know exactly what parts I need to switch over the gears. Is it just the ring and pinion, or are there other parts involved. I have a 05 GT, 5sp with 1500 miles on it. I appreciate any help.

Default RE: Another gear question.

essentially that is all you need plus an installation set. i wouldn't expect to do it myself though. setup is/can be complicated to ensure durability and quietness.
